LACTOBACILLUS/SACCHAROMYCES/HYDROLYZED RICE BRAN FERMENT FILTRATE

A hydrolyzed rice bran ferment using Lactobacillus and Saccharomyces — the hydrolysis step breaks bran components into smaller, more skin-absorbable bioactive compounds.
Skin benefits
- Hydrolysis pre-breaks rice bran components for enhanced bioavailability
- Ferulic acid and oryzanol antioxidant components
- Conditioning low-molecular-weight peptides
- Soothing for sensitive skin
Known concerns
- Compositional variability between batches
- Rare sensitization in grain or yeast-allergic individuals
